About Peter Carl Bosiak
Peter Carl Bosiak Jr. was born on November 23, 1945. Following a rather lengthy stay in high school and particulary inspired by his history teacher, Peter made his way to Peterborough Teacher's College, where he graduated in 1968. Following several years of teaching in Kingston and a year spent playing hockey and travelling in Europe, he returned to Stirling. While teaching at the Junior and Senior Elementary Schools, Peter completed his Honour's History degree at Queen's University. He was married to Barbara Joan Barker on March 20, 1976 and they have two daughters. Elizabeth Ann (Beth) was born in 1979 and Nicole Marie Lucretia in 1981.
Although a hockey, golf, and football player, Peter's favourite sport to coach was volleyball. He was very fortunate to have coached a number of great young athletes at the elementary, secondary, club and regional levels.
In addition to teaching, Peter managed a strawberry operation for 20 years on land the family continues to own in the village. The whol family pitched in and the long hours Beth and Nicole spent at "The Patch" helped fund their university studies. Peter retired from teaching in 1999.
